Pregnant Mother Killed in Tragic Crash, Unborn Baby Lost

On the evening of November 3, 2025, a devastating car crash in Hornsby, Sydney claimed the life of a pregnant woman and her unborn child. Samanvitha Dhareshwar, 33, who was eight months pregnant, was walking with her husband and their 3-year-old son when she was allegedly struck by a white BMW driven by 19-year-old P-plate driver Aaron Papazoglu.

According to police, Papazoglu's vehicle collided with a Kia Carnival that had stopped to allow the family to cross the road, pushing the Kia forward and hitting Dhareshwar. She suffered catastrophic injuries and was rushed to the hospital, where she and her unborn baby could not be saved.

Papazoglu, a university student with no prior criminal or driving offenses, was later arrested and charged with dangerous driving causing death and causing the loss of a foetus. His lawyer argued that the collision was a "tragic outcome to a series of unfortunate events," but the magistrate denied bail due to the seriousness of the charges.
